Summary of the Inventive Concept

A mobile weight training system designed for specialized environments, such as high-security areas, disaster relief zones, extreme weather conditions, high-altitude environments, and search and rescue operations, providing users with a compact, adaptable, and secure weight training solution.

Background and Problem Solved

The original mobile weight training system, while innovative, has limitations in terms of its adaptability to specific, niche environments. The new inventive concept addresses these limitations by providing a system that can be tailored to meet the unique demands of high-security, disaster relief, extreme weather, high-altitude, and search and rescue environments, ensuring users can maintain peak fitness in challenging situations.

Detailed Description of the Inventive Concept

The new inventive concept comprises a collapsible barbell, a set of weight holders, a system of filler bags, and a case that doubles as a weight-bench. The weight holders are designed to be tamper-evident, water-resistant, or compact and lightweight, depending on the specific environment. The filler bags can be filled with available materials in disaster relief areas or with a weighted, high-density material resistant to unauthorized access in high-security environments. The case is designed to be wind-resistant, compact, and lightweight for easy transportation. The system allows users to conduct weight training exercises in a variety of challenging environments, ensuring they can maintain peak fitness and performance.

Alternative Embodiments and Variations

Alternative embodiments of the inventive concept could include the use of different materials for the weight holders and filler bags, such as advanced polymers or metals, or the integration of additional features, such as sensors to track user performance or environmental conditions. Variations could include systems designed for specific environments, such as a system for underwater weight training or a system for weight training in zero-gravity environments.

Obviousness Rationale

A PHOSITA would recognize that the source patent's flexible weight holder concept provides a foundational design that can be readily adapted to specialized environments by modifying material properties, configuration, and intended use. The core technical principles of a modular, flexible weight system remain consistent across the PTD's variations, with modifications representing predictable design iterations based on specific environmental constraints. The PTD's innovations represent logical extensions of the source patent's core technical teachings about portable, flexible weight training systems.
